S-Nitroso-N-acetyl-L-cysteine ethyl ester (SNACET) and N-acetyl-L-cysteine ethyl ester (NACET)–Cysteine-based drug candidates with unique pharmacological profiles for oral use as NO, H2S and GSH suppliers and as antioxidants: Results and overview
S-Nitrosothiols or thionitrites with the general formula RSNO are formally composed of the nitrosyl cation (NO+) and a thiolate (RS-), the base of the corresponding acids RSH. The smallest S-nitrosothiol is HSNO and derives from hydrogen sulfide (HSH, H2S). The most common physiological S-nitrosothiols are derived from the amino acid L-cysteine (CysSH). متن کاملN-Acetyl-5-chloro-3-nitro-l-tyrosine ethyl ester
The title compound, C(13)H(15)ClN(2)O(6), was synthesized by hypochlorous acid-mediated chlorination of N-acetyl-3-nitro-l-tyrosine ethyl ester. The OH group forms an intra-molecular O-H⋯O hydrogen bond to the nitro group and the N-H group forms an inter-molecular N-H⋯O hydrogen bonds to an amide O atom, linking the mol-ecules into chains along [100]. متن کاملAn ESR study of radical kinetics in L-alpha-amino-n-butyric acid hydrochloride containing L-cysteine hydrochloride.
On annealing at temperatures near 100 degrees C, carbon-centered radicals migrate to sulfur-centered radicals in X-irradiated crystals of L-alpha-amino-n-butyric acid hydrochloride, CH3CH2CH(NH3-Cl)COOH, containing L-cysteine hydrochloride, SHCH2CH(NH3Cl)COOH. متن کاملThe Decomposition of Cysteine in Aqueous Solution*
In a recent study (1) it was shown that cystine could be decomposed by boiling distilled water with the formation of cysteine, hydrogen sulfide, and elementary sulfur. The decomposition of cysteine under similar conditions should aid in a clearer explanation of the mechanisms involved in the breakdown of these two amino acids.
